STAT+: Is RFK Jr. coming for your Dunkin’?

Last updated: March 4, 2026 9:10 am
Share
STAT+: Is RFK Jr. coming for your Dunkin’?
SHARE

Health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. recently discussed the Trump administration’s efforts to improve the nation’s food supply during a speech in Texas. He highlighted the administration’s plans to potentially remove certain ingredients from the market if their safety cannot be proven. Kennedy specifically mentioned popular coffee chains Dunkin’ Donuts and Starbucks, questioning the safety of drinks with high sugar content, such as a teenage girl consuming an iced coffee with 115 grams of sugar.

Kennedy’s comments have sparked discussions about the need for stricter regulations on sugary beverages and the importance of transparency in the food industry.
